Dish Network has launched high-definition (HD) channels in 14 additional local markets, bringing their total local hi-def coverage to 170 markets covering 96-percent of U.S. households.
Dish subscribers in the following markets can now get local channels in HD: Augusta, Ga.; Davenport, Iowa; Evansville, Ind.; Monroe, La.; Paducah, Ky.; Rochester, Minn.; San Angelo, Texas; Shreveport, La.; Wichita, Kan. and Wilmington, N.C.
On Aug. 18, DISH Network will launch local HD programming in Bangor, Maine; Macon, Ga.; Rochester, N.Y.; and Traverse City, Mich.
